What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ly business class from Los Angeles to Madrid?

The average price of all flights from Los Angeles to Madrid cl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

Look for departures on Saturday when prices are cheapest and avoid leaving on a Friday, as it's usually the priciest day. When flying back from Madrid, Monday is the cheapest day to fly and Wednesday is the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ly Business Class from Los Angeles to Madrid?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for flights from Los Angeles to Madrid,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for Business Class flights from Los Angeles to Madrid is February, where tickets cost $3,733 (round-trip)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are September and April,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$5,657 and $5,432 respectively.

How far in advance should I book my Business Class ticket from Los Angeles to Madrid?

To get a below average price, you should book around 2 weeks before departure, which saves you about 2%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 26 weeks before departure.

Which airlines offer Business Class tickets between Los Angeles and Madrid?

There are 13 airlines that fly Business Class from Los Angeles to Madrid. They are: United Airlines, Royal Air Maroc, Avianca, Turkish Airlines, TAP AIR PORTUGAL, Delta, Finnair, Air France, British Airways, Iberia, SWISS, Lufthansa and American Airlines. The cheapest price of all airlines flying this route was found with United Airlines at $1,080 for a round-trip flight. On average, the best prices for flying Business Class on this route can be found at Avianca.
